Skip to content
Snippets Groups Projects
Commit 7d8d8a55 authored by OZGCloud's avatar OZGCloud
Browse files

OZG-4391 OZG-4417 extract method

parent 7000963a
Branches
Tags
No related merge requests found
...@@ -335,43 +335,51 @@ class VorgangWithEingangProzessorTest { ...@@ -335,43 +335,51 @@ class VorgangWithEingangProzessorTest {
@Test @Test
void shouldReturnFalseOnEmptyEingang() { void shouldReturnFalseOnEmptyEingang() {
var hasEnabled = callProcessor(VorgangWithEingangTestFactory.createBuilder().eingang(null).build()); var vorgangWithEmptyEingang = createVorgang(null);
var hasEnabled = callProcessor(vorgangWithEmptyEingang);
assertThat(hasEnabled).isFalse(); assertThat(hasEnabled).isFalse();
} }
@Test @Test
void shouldReturnFalseOnEmptyEingangHeader() { void shouldReturnFalseOnEmptyEingangHeader() {
var hasEnabled = callProcessor( var vorgangWithEmptyEingangHeader = EingangTestFactory.createBuilder().header(null).build();
VorgangWithEingangTestFactory.createBuilder().eingang(EingangTestFactory.createBuilder().header(null).build()).build());
var hasEnabled = callProcessor(createVorgang(vorgangWithEmptyEingangHeader));
assertThat(hasEnabled).isFalse(); assertThat(hasEnabled).isFalse();
} }
@Test @Test
void shouldReturnFalseOnEmptyFormEngineName() { void shouldReturnFalseOnEmptyFormEngineName() {
var hasEnabled = callProcessor( var vorgangWithEmptyFormEngineName = createVorgang(
VorgangWithEingangTestFactory.createBuilder().eingang( EingangTestFactory.createBuilder().header(EingangHeaderTestFactory.createBuilder().formEngineName(null).build()).build());
EingangTestFactory.createBuilder().header(EingangHeaderTestFactory.createBuilder().formEngineName(null).build())
.build()).build()); var hasEnabled = callProcessor(vorgangWithEmptyFormEngineName);
assertThat(hasEnabled).isFalse(); assertThat(hasEnabled).isFalse();
} }
@Test @Test
void shouldReturnFalseOnEmptyFormId() { void shouldReturnFalseOnEmptyFormId() {
var vorgangWithEmptyFormId = createVorgang(
EingangTestFactory.createBuilder().header(EingangHeaderTestFactory.createBuilder().formId(null).build()).build());
var hasEnabled = callProcessor( var hasEnabled = callProcessor(
VorgangWithEingangTestFactory.createBuilder().eingang( vorgangWithEmptyFormId);
EingangTestFactory.createBuilder().header(EingangHeaderTestFactory.createBuilder().formId(null).build())
.build()).build());
assertThat(hasEnabled).isFalse(); assertThat(hasEnabled).isFalse();
} }
boolean callProcessor(VorgangWithEingang vorgang) { private boolean callProcessor(VorgangWithEingang vorgang) {
return processor.hasVorgangCreateBescheidEnabled(vorgang); return processor.hasVorgangCreateBescheidEnabled(vorgang);
} }
private VorgangWithEingang createVorgang(Eingang eingang) {
return VorgangWithEingangTestFactory.createBuilder().eingang(eingang).build();
}
} }
@Nested @Nested
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ment